The Viscosupplementation Market is facing a changing competitive environment as healthcare providers, patients, regulators, and pharmaceutical companies increasingly evaluate the effectiveness, affordability, and long-term value of injectable therapies for joint pain. Viscosupplementation, which involves injecting hyaluronic acid-based products into joints to improve lubrication and support mobility, has established an important position in the management of osteoarthritis, particularly knee osteoarthritis. However, the market is not immune to external pressures.

Several threats could influence future market expansion, including inconsistent clinical outcomes, competition from alternative treatments, regulatory uncertainty, pricing pressure, reimbursement limitations, and the growing availability of lower-cost substitutes. These factors can affect physician adoption, patient demand, manufacturer profitability, and long-term investment in product development.

Inconsistent Clinical Evidence and Treatment Outcomes

One of the most significant threats facing the Viscosupplementation Market is the continued debate surrounding clinical effectiveness. Although many patients report pain relief and improved mobility after receiving hyaluronic acid injections, clinical outcomes can vary substantially. Some patients experience meaningful improvement, while others report limited or short-term benefits.

This variability can make physicians more cautious when recommending viscosupplementation. Healthcare professionals increasingly rely on evidence-based treatment guidelines and comparative studies when selecting therapies. If clinical evidence does not consistently demonstrate a clear advantage over placebo injections, corticosteroids, physical therapy, or other interventions, adoption may become more selective.

The perception of inconsistent efficacy can also influence patient expectations. Patients who do not experience satisfactory relief may be less likely to pursue repeat injections or recommend the treatment to others. Over time, this can limit treatment continuity and reduce overall market demand.

Competition from Alternative Therapies

The availability of alternative treatments represents another major threat. Corticosteroid injections remain widely used for short-term pain relief, while platelet-rich plasma therapies, physical rehabilitation, weight management programs, oral medications, and surgical interventions compete for the same patient population.

Platelet-rich plasma has attracted attention in several orthopedic and sports medicine settings because of growing interest in regenerative medicine. Although clinical evidence and treatment protocols remain variable, the perception that regenerative therapies may provide longer-term benefits can influence patient preferences.

Noninvasive approaches also pose a threat. Advances in physical therapy, digital rehabilitation platforms, wearable devices, and personalized exercise programs may reduce dependence on injectable treatments for certain patients. As healthcare systems increasingly promote conservative management before invasive procedures, viscosupplementation providers may face stronger competition from noninjection treatment pathways.

Pricing Pressure and Cost Sensitivity

Cost pressure is a persistent challenge for manufacturers and healthcare providers. Viscosupplementation products can vary considerably in price depending on formulation, injection schedule, brand positioning, and distribution channel. When patients are required to pay a substantial portion of treatment costs themselves, affordability becomes a major factor in treatment decisions.

Economic uncertainty can intensify this threat. During periods of financial pressure, patients may delay elective treatments or choose lower-cost alternatives. Healthcare providers may also favor therapies that offer more predictable reimbursement or lower acquisition costs.

The growing availability of generic, lower-priced, or locally manufactured hyaluronic acid products can further intensify competition. While price competition may improve accessibility, it can reduce profit margins for established manufacturers and make it more difficult to fund research, clinical development, and product innovation.

Reimbursement and Insurance Limitations

Insurance coverage is a critical factor influencing the adoption of viscosupplementation. In some healthcare systems, reimbursement policies may impose restrictions on eligibility, treatment frequency, product selection, or repeat injections. Changes in coverage policies can immediately affect patient access and provider demand.

If insurers determine that certain viscosupplementation products provide insufficient value compared with less expensive treatments, coverage may become more restrictive. Patients may then face higher out-of-pocket costs, reducing their willingness to undergo treatment.

Reimbursement uncertainty also creates challenges for manufacturers planning long-term investments. Companies may hesitate to introduce premium products or pursue costly clinical trials if future reimbursement conditions are unpredictable. This can slow innovation and limit the development of advanced formulations.

Regulatory Complexity and Approval Challenges

Regulatory requirements represent another important threat to the Viscosupplementation Market. Hyaluronic acid products may be subject to different regulatory classifications and approval standards depending on the country or region. Manufacturers operating across multiple markets must manage complex requirements related to clinical evidence, product quality, manufacturing, labeling, and post-market monitoring.

Regulatory authorities may also increase scrutiny of product claims and clinical performance. Any changes in requirements could raise development costs and extend the time needed to launch new products.

Smaller companies may be particularly vulnerable to these pressures. Limited financial resources can make it difficult to complete extensive clinical studies or maintain compliance with evolving regulatory standards. As a result, regulatory complexity may encourage market consolidation and reduce the number of new entrants.

Product Safety Concerns and Adverse Events

Although viscosupplementation is generally considered minimally invasive, injections can involve risks such as pain, swelling, inflammation, infection, or allergic reactions. Serious complications are uncommon, but negative treatment experiences can affect patient confidence.

Product-related safety concerns can have a broader impact if a specific formulation becomes associated with unexpected adverse events. Product recalls, manufacturing problems, or reports of contamination could damage consumer trust and create reputational challenges for manufacturers.

In a competitive healthcare market, safety perception can strongly influence physician behavior. Even isolated concerns may encourage healthcare providers to consider alternative treatments, particularly when multiple therapies are available for the same condition.

Dependence on Osteoarthritis Treatment Demand

The Viscosupplementation Market is closely connected to the prevalence and treatment patterns of osteoarthritis. While the aging population creates a large potential patient base, market growth depends on whether patients and physicians choose viscosupplementation over other treatment options.

Changes in clinical guidelines could affect this relationship. If treatment recommendations increasingly prioritize exercise, weight reduction, physical therapy, or other interventions before injections, the timing of viscosupplementation use may be delayed. In some cases, patients may never progress to injectable treatment.

This dependence creates a structural threat because manufacturers have limited control over broader treatment protocols and healthcare policies.

Technological Substitution and Treatment Innovation

Rapid innovation in orthopedic medicine may create new substitutes for conventional viscosupplementation. Advances in tissue engineering, regenerative medicine, biomaterials, and targeted drug delivery could eventually introduce treatments that provide longer-lasting or more predictable outcomes.

Future therapies may combine biological agents with advanced delivery systems, potentially reducing the need for repeated injections. If these technologies demonstrate superior clinical performance, conventional hyaluronic acid products could face significant displacement.

Even incremental innovation can create pressure. Longer-acting formulations, combination injections, and new regenerative approaches may attract both physicians and investors, increasing competition for research funding and market attention.

Supply Chain and Manufacturing Risks

Manufacturing and supply chain disruptions can also threaten market stability. Viscosupplementation products depend on reliable access to pharmaceutical-grade raw materials, specialized production facilities, packaging components, and quality-control systems.

Disruptions caused by transportation challenges, shortages of raw materials, geopolitical instability, or manufacturing failures can affect product availability. Smaller manufacturers may be particularly exposed because they often have fewer production sites and less flexibility in sourcing.

Any disruption that leads to shortages can create difficulties for healthcare providers and reduce patient confidence in specific brands or treatment programs.

Market Fragmentation and Brand Competition

Intense competition among manufacturers can create additional pressure. The presence of numerous products with similar therapeutic objectives makes differentiation increasingly difficult. Companies must compete through product quality, clinical evidence, pricing, injection schedules, physician relationships, and distribution networks.

Excessive competition can lead to promotional pressure and declining prices. Manufacturers that fail to establish strong brand recognition may struggle to maintain market share.

The Viscosupplementation Market may also experience consolidation as companies seek economies of scale and broader distribution capabilities. While consolidation can strengthen larger businesses, it may make smaller firms more vulnerable to acquisition or market exit.
